Output 94c38df08cfc18fef4b49be603a82f8a2f5fbedb8935c377fc00fb0ae6eea6ed:1

value
252904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ed83ec9671408b571419f6f050b651eeece740 OP_EQUAL
address
369itc6kELCpUbepnENEYLAZ8W4bK19TXU
transaction
94c38df08cfc18fef4b49be603a82f8a2f5fbedb8935c377fc00fb0ae6eea6ed
confirmations
321626
spent
true